Pastor’s Column Fr. Thomas Keller

Most parishes tried to push through the first few weeks and then months of the mandatory government lock-down. We cancelled public events to “slow the spread.” Luckily for Assumption, we already livestreamed our Masses and our audience of 5 to 20 people per Mass shot up into the hundreds and in some cases, even the thousands. But live streaming Masses isn’t enough to keep us all connected with Christ and His Church for an extended period of time. We are grateful that we can have public Masses and some other limited events, even if it is with a smaller capacity. Of course, our ability to meet can change if the coronavirus continues to spread and it is apparent to everyone that the epidemic is not going away.

So, the question is - how can we continue the work of Christ when we are prohibited from meeting in large groups, and large segments of our community do not feel safe to meet in our normal manner? How can individuals in vulnerable populations participate in the sacraments or resume their place in parish organizations? Some groups like ACTS may be on hiatus for a while, but other groups need to meet for the good of the parish and the good of the Church. There are two realistic options: “Limited socially distanced outdoor events” and “hybrid in-person and online events.”

“Limited capacity socially distanced outdoor events” means that we can meet outdoors in group of 50 or less as long as everyone agrees to maintain 6 feet from each other. We could require sign-ups to schedule a place at these events and limit them to individuals in vulnerable populations since we currently have other regularly sched-uled events for those who can participate in them. We could schedule: 1. Occasional outdoor weekend evening Masses for small groups of vulnerable parishioners who can’t make it to our regularly scheduled Masses. 2. Occasional outdoor Adoration and confession times for the same group of people. 3. Outdoor faith sharing and social meetings. Our youth ministry meets regularly outdoors on the parking lot and some members of our senior ministry meet outdoors in the courtyard. We had some very successful outdoor movie nights. All these meetings comply with social-distancing guidelines, so we could expand these options for more groups.

“Hybrid in-person and online events” means that some parishioners may be at Assumption in the Church Lower Level or the Rectory Basement and others may be participating in the same meeting at home via the Internet. Deacon Dave Schaefer recently equipped these rooms so they can host hybrid in-person and online meetings. Some possible hybrid meetings include:

1. Inside Catholicism. This was very popular last year. This year, we will focus on the interior spiritual life of a Catholic. This is particularly timely as it is difficult for everyone to gather together to pray. 2. Parish Meetings. Parish Council, Finance Council, St Vincent de Paul Society and our other committees that have been on hold since March can begin meeting again in the hybrid style. 3. “Cyber Seniors.” Our Senior Ministry is working on a program to assist seniors who need help with technology to connect online with family, friends and other parishioners. We will announce more information about Cyber Seniors as it becomes available.

As soon as we have more information about these events and programs, we will publish it on our website and in the Good News Messenger. We also plan on occasionally publishing a parish newsletter during the ongoing pandemic on Flocknote to help connect parishioners.

In the meantime, pray for an end to this pestilence!

God bless, Fr. Keller

Statistics as of August 5, 2020: Population of St. Louis County: 998,692 COVID-19 cases: 13,788 (1.37%) Population of 63128 zip code: 29,832 COVID-19 cases: 277 (0.92%)

COVID-19

Information

Our zip code (63128) has 88 more positive coronavirus cases that last week. For comparison, it took about 4 months to just to get to 75 cases. Then it took another month to add 100 additional cases. Now we have nearly as many new cases in a week. So, please be aware, although only about 1% of the 63128 population has been infected since March 15th, the virus is beginning to exponentially spread in our area. Some Assumption families are voluntarily isolating because a member of their family had come in contact with someone with coronavirus or one of their family members tested positive themselves. But they were not on our property after exposure, so no contract tracing is necessary. If you are infected with COVID-19 and have been on Assumption property while you were contagious, even if you have not had symptoms; please contact Fr. Keller so we can assist with contact tracing. Your anonymity will be respected.

St. Louis County Coronavirus Social Distancing Guidelines: - Building capacities are limited to 25%. (See below for current room capacities.) - Face masks must be worn for all events including worship services. - Individuals or non-family members should maintain a six-foot separation.

Archdiocese of St. Louis Coronavirus Directives: - The obligation to attend Sunday Mass remains temporarily lifted. - Vulnerable individuals and those over 60 years old should take additional precautions. - Holy Communion may be received on the tongue in the main aisle from the priest. Ministers on the side aisle will distribute Holy Communion in the hand. - The Presentation of Offertory Gifts, the Sign of Peace, and Communion under both kinds are suspended, and Holy Water has been removed.

Assumption Parish Coronavirus Accommodations: - Baskets for donations and hand sanitizer are located near the doors of the church. - Free masks are located in the back of church. - Alternating pews are used to increase distance between worshippers. - Masses are livestreamed and most recent information can be found at www.assumptionstl.org.

- Funerals, baptisms, weddings, and parish meetings are permitted provided St. Louis County social distancing

guidelines are followed.

- Funeral Visitations are permitted for one hour prior to the Funeral Mass.

- Funeral Luncheons and other events serving food are permitted in the Church Lower Level. However, at this

time, only catered food is permitted. Food must be box-lunch or served by caterers. Potluck, or self-serve

buffets and drink bars are not permitted.

- Due to the configuration of the confessionals, all confessions are heard behind the screen.

- Outdoor meetings may be scheduled in the School Courtyard and the Outdoor Classroom. Please bring your

own chairs.

- The Church Lower Level and the Rectory Basement are available for “hybrid in-person and online” meetings.

Important Announcement

Regarding

“Protecting God’s Children”

The Archdiocese of St. Louis has developed a new system for safe environment compliance called Prevent and Protect STL. Everyone ministering to minors and vulnerable adults in the Archdiocese are required to register in the new system. This includes all clergy, employees and volunteers who are currently in compliance and those new to service. All new registrants will need to attend a Protecting God’s Children workshop. For those who have already attended a Protecting God’s Children workshop, your previous training date will transfer to this new system. In addition, every-one will register for an updated background screening, view two online training modules on abuse reporting and the Code of Ethical Con-duct, and agree to the updated Code of Ethical Conduct. All information and links can be found on the parish website on the Education & Activities for Children tab under Safe Envi-ronment. If you have any questions, please contact Diane Higgins at (314) 487-6520 ext. 1236 or email [email protected].
